Cher On Trump: “I Feel Like I’m Yelling ‘Fire’ And No One Is Listening”

Apparently, Cher can turn back time, because we’re now living in some moment before her Farewell tour.

She just announced a residency in Las Vegas in February and May, and additional shows will be scheduled later.

In order to promote the upcoming extravaganza, she popped ’round to the TODAY show to touch upon subjects as varied as Donald Trump and growing older.

Here is some of the wisdom she imparted:

On the possibility of a Trump presidency: 

I feel like I’m yelling ‘fire,’ and no one is listening…I care about the country, and I know that the people that are following Trump, they care about the country, too. But I don’t think it’s the same country I care about.”

On why she’s backing Clinton:

She’s done some things that I’m sure she wishes she hadn’t done. And she’s done things — I can’t back every play. But I think that if she has the chance to be a great president, she will rise to that occasion.”

On turning 70:

I just don’t know how to accept it. I don’t want to either. But I don’t really know how to. I look in the mirror and I see this old lady looking back at me. I have no idea how she got there. If I put 70 candles on my cake I would blow my brains out…”

On touring: 

 The older you are the harder it is.”
